This would be the "before" version of Willow from "Chosen," the final episode of "BtVS," because there is also a White Witch Willow figure in this final quartet of Diamond Select Toys deluxe figures. After Willow uses her wicca powers on the scythe that Buffy freed from a chunk of stone two episodes earlier, the white magick not only spreads the power of the Slayer from the weapon to all of the Potentials in the Hellmouth and around the world, it turns Willow's hair white; hence, White Witch Willow (which means she is a good witch and not a bad witch). The "Chosen" Willow looks as much like Alyson Hannigan as any of the other Willow figures in my massive but no longer growing collection. There are 29 points of articulation and to save you the bother of counting them they would be a double one for the neck, shoulders, biceps, above and below the elbows, doubles for the wrists, chest, doubles for the hips, both above and blow the knees, doubles for the ankles, and toes. For accessories the figure comes with the scythe in question, a laptop computer, and a nice assortment of five candles (which are not based on the candles Willow used to work her big spell in "Chosen"). Also included in this series, which as of this date is scheduled to be the last one of "BtVS" and "Angel" figures from DST, are deluxe action figures of Kendra from Season 2's "Becoming" and a "Chosen" Kennedy.
